How-To Guide · Ecommerce Integration

Shopify Google Pixel Setup: Track Conversions the Right Way

Step-by-step guide to setting up Google Ads conversion tracking on Shopify using the Google & YouTube app. Covers purchase events, verification, and what to avoid.

TL;DR Use the Google & YouTube app. It's the official, fully supported method. It auto-configures Purchase, Add to Cart, and Checkout Started conversion events the moment you link your Google Ads account. Custom pixels are unsupported and risky. Skip them unless a developer owns the full setup.

4 min read By Updated 0 steps

Originally published .

> Quick answer: Use the Google & YouTube app on Shopify. It's the only officially supported method. It auto-configures Purchase, Add to Cart, and Checkout Started events when you connect Google Ads. Custom pixels are unsupported and can lose data silently.

Getting conversion tracking right is the difference between running blind and knowing your ROI. This guide walks you through the fastest, safest setup for Shopify stores running Google Ads.

What is Google Ads Conversion Tracking?

Conversion tracking tells Google which ad clicks turned into sales. Without it, Smart Bidding has no signal to optimize toward.

Why conversion tracking matters for ecommerce

Every dollar you spend on Google Ads needs a return signal. Conversion tracking gives Google's algorithm what it needs to shift spend toward buyers, not just browsers. Campaigns running without conversion data rely on guesswork for bidding. That costs money.

Key events Shopify tracks (purchase, add-to-cart, checkout)

Per Google's Merchant Center Help, three conversion events are auto-configured when you link your Google Ads account. Purchase, Add to Cart, and Checkout Started. All three are set as account defaults. Purchase carries the strongest signal for ecommerce Smart Bidding strategies. The others support upper-funnel optimization and audience building.

This is the only fully supported path. Per Google Tag Manager Help, the Google & YouTube app is the easiest way to set up measurement across Google Ads, Analytics, YouTube, and Merchant Center on Shopify.

Step 1: Install the Google & YouTube app on Shopify

  1. Open your Shopify Admin.
  2. Go to Apps and search for "Google & YouTube."
  3. Click Install and follow the on-screen prompts.

Step 2: Connect your Google Ads account

  1. Open the app and navigate to Settings.
  2. Under Google Ads, click Connect.
  3. Sign in with the Google account that owns your Ads account.
  4. Select the correct account from the dropdown and confirm.

Step 3: Configure conversion events

  1. Inside the app, go to Measure conversions.
  2. Review the three default events. Purchase, Add to Cart, Checkout Started.
  3. Confirm each is toggled on.
  4. Open Google Ads and verify each event shows as an account default under Goals > Conversions.

Step 4: Verify tracking with Google Tag Assistant

Install the Google Tag Assistant Chrome extension. Visit your storefront with Tag Assistant active. It flags missing tags, duplicate tags, and firing errors. Duplicate conversion sources inflate your reported conversion counts and corrupt your bidding signals. Fix every flagged issue before spending any budget.

Alternative. Custom Pixel (Advanced)

When custom pixels are used

Some merchants inject Google tags via a JavaScript custom pixel. This typically happens when a developer manages tags independently or when the Google & YouTube app conflicts with an existing measurement stack.

Limitations and risks of custom implementation

This matters. Per Google Ads Help, Google support cannot help troubleshoot custom pixel issues. It is not a supported implementation. Shopify also does not support custom pixel debugging, meaning merchants using GTM via a custom pixel need a Shopify Partner to resolve problems.

Custom pixels run inside Shopify's sandbox. Core signals like pageviews and purchase values may still transmit. But advanced events and parameters can drop without warning. You may not discover the data loss until your campaigns underperform. Stick with the official app unless a developer owns and maintains the full setup.

Verify Your Setup is Working

Check conversions are reporting in Google Ads

Go to Goals > Conversions > Summary in Google Ads. Status should read "Recording conversions." If it shows "No recent conversions," run a test purchase on your storefront and wait for data to populate. Check Tag Assistant again to confirm no duplicate tags are active.

Troubleshoot common issues

No conversions recording. Confirm the Google & YouTube app is connected and the right Google Ads account is linked. Disconnect and reconnect if needed.

Inflated conversion counts. You likely have two active tracking sources. Check whether a custom pixel and the app are both firing. Remove one source entirely.

Tag Assistant errors after reinstall. Reconnect the Google & YouTube app from scratch. Rerun Tag Assistant to confirm the tags are clean before resuming campaigns.

Next Steps. Generate High-Performing Ad Creative

Tracking is live. Now your ads need to drive the conversions worth measuring.

Once tracking is live, test variations with Coinis Image Ads

Coinis Image Ads generates ad creatives from a product URL. Paste your Shopify product link and get multiple image variations in seconds. Test different creative angles across campaigns. Your conversion data tells you what wins. Coinis does not publish directly to Google Ads today. Export your creatives and upload them to Google Ads directly.

Use AI copywriting to align ad messaging with conversion goals

Ad copy matched to the conversion event outperforms generic messaging. A purchase-focused campaign needs urgency, price clarity, and a direct offer. Coinis AI Copywriting generates headlines and body copy from your Brand Profile and campaign goal. Start with the right message on day one. Let conversion data sharpen it from there.

Or let Coinis do it.

From a product URL to a live Meta campaign. AI-generated creatives. On-brand copy. Direct publish to Facebook and Instagram. Real performance reporting. All in one platform.

Start free. Upgrade when you're ready.

Start free →

15 AI tokens a month. No credit card.

Frequently Asked Questions

What is the recommended way to add a Google pixel to Shopify?

Use the Google & YouTube app from the Shopify App Store. It is the only officially supported method and auto-configures Purchase, Add to Cart, and Checkout Started conversion events when you connect your Google Ads account.

Can I use a custom pixel for Google Ads conversion tracking on Shopify?

You can, but it is not recommended. Per Google Ads Help, Google support cannot troubleshoot custom pixel issues. Custom pixels run in Shopify's sandbox and may drop advanced events and parameters without warning.

How do I verify my Google conversion tracking is working on Shopify?

Install the Google Tag Assistant Chrome extension, visit your storefront, and check for tag errors or duplicates. Then check Google Ads under Goals > Conversions > Summary to confirm the status shows 'Recording conversions'.

What conversion events does Shopify track for Google Ads?

Per Google's Merchant Center Help, the three default conversion events are Purchase, Add to Cart, and Checkout Started. These are auto-configured as account defaults when you link Google Ads through the Google & YouTube app.

Stop hustling

You just read the manual way. Coinis does it all.

Every step above takes hours of manual work. Coinis automates it. Free to start. No credit card. Pay only when you need more volume.

Steps 1–2

Goal + Audience

AI analyzes your brand from a URL. Targets the right buyers automatically.

Steps 3–4

Channels + Budget

One-click launch to Meta. Smart budget allocation out of the box.

Step 5

Ad Creatives

Paste a link. Get dozens of professional ads in minutes.

Steps 6–7

Launch + Track

Live dashboard. Real ROAS. AI suggests what to optimize next.

15 credits day one
No credit card
Free forever tier
Pay only for volume
Start free

You just learned the hard way. Here's the easy way.

Coinis generates ad creatives, launches campaigns, and tracks results. One platform. One click. No ad expertise required.

Try Coinis free